I had a lean condition on my drivers bank earlier this year, I checked the plugs to pinpoint if it was a certain cylinder.......turns out it was number 1. So I bought a new spark plug= no difference, then I bought a new injector= no difference, swapped out the o2 sensors= no difference, it didn't follow the sensor to the pass. side. I even swapped a coil from the passenger side but still no difference. My Fitech fuel trim log was registering a 20% enrichment. Used a heat gun and the cylinder was about 100 degrees cooler than the others on the same bank but I thought its close proximity to the fans was causing this.
I ended up swapping the coil harness and adding a drivers side ground and that corrected things instantly. Checked the fuel trim and the computer was no longer compensating with the additional fuel on the drivers bank. So maybe it could be something similar to the issues I had?
